中文摘要:
      在EPDM/白炭黑胶料的过氧化物硫化体系中,加入三羟甲基丙烷三丙烯酸酯(TMPTA)能够迅速提高硫化胶的交联效率,增大网络密度,缩短硫化时间;当TMPTA用量为0.5份时,EPDM硫化胶的拉伸强度保持率和扯断伸长率保持率达到最大值;在2.0份过氧化二异丙苯(DCP)中加入0.5份TMPTA,胶料的硫化时间比单独使用3.0份DCP缩短40%,且硫化胶的定伸应力、拉伸强度和撕裂强度均明显提高。
英文摘要:
      The improvement of peroxide-crosslinked EPDM properties with trimethylolpropane triacrylate(TMPTA) was studied.It was found that the crosslinking rate and crosslinking density increased and the curing cycle time reduced with the addition of TMPTA in the peroxide crosslinking system for EPDM/silica compound;the maximum tensile strength retension and elongation ultimate retension of EPDM vulcanizate after aging were obtained by adding 0.5 phr of TMPTA;the curing cycle time of EPDM compound with the addition of TMPTA(0.5 phr)in DCP(2.0 phr)reduced by 40% when compared to that with no TMPTA in DCP(3.0 phr),and the modulus,tensile strength and tear strength of the former vulcanizate improved remarkably.
